Monbiot lays it on the linePoliticians here and abroad are refusing to listen to arguments against biofuelsPosted by biodiversivist (Guest Contributor) at 11:53 AM on 07 Nov 2007Gristmill reader KO has directed me to George Monbiot's latest article in the Guardian. You folks out there with "biodiesel / no war for oil" stickers are accused of perpetuating a crime against humanity. The article is a (concise and articulate) compilation of my most recent rants against biofuels. Some money quotes: ... the superior purchasing power of drivers in the rich world means that they will snatch food from people's mouths. Run your car on virgin biofuel, and other people will starve.
